Ukraine continues to face relentless aerial attacks, while its military’s hard‑won expertise in drone defence is drawing global attention and requests for help from other nations.

Over the past week, Ukrainian President Volodymyr Zelenskyy reported that Russian forces have launched waves of drones and guided weapons against Ukrainian towns and infrastructure. These assaults have targeted energy facilities, housing, and transportation networks, underscoring the heavy toll this conflict has taken on everyday life. Civilians living under the constant drone threat continue to adapt, seeking shelter when alarms sound and pressing on with work, school, and family life despite fear and uncertainty. This persistent strain places emotional, physical, and economic pressure on families across the country.

While facing these attacks, Ukraine’s defence forces have built highly capable counter‑drone systems that have proven effective in protecting cities and strategic targets. Rather than keeping these tactics to themselves, Ukraine is now sharing its expertise with allied nations confronting similar threats. The United States, the UAE, Qatar, Bahrain, Jordan and Kuwait have expressed interest in Ukraine’s experience in countering Iranian‑made “Shahed” drones - the same type used extensively by Russia in its assaults.

While Ukraine remains careful not to deplete its own defences, it is deploying groups of drone defence specialists and providing training and low‑cost interceptor drones to help protect other countries’ military bases and civilian areas.

This cooperation has practical and spiritual weight. In Jordan and the Gulf region, Ukrainian drone teams are deploying to train local forces and support protection efforts. Kyiv emphasises that any assistance given abroad is balanced with the need to keep its own skies defended. Many governments see Ukraine’s battlefield experience as invaluable in confronting new aerial threats that have emerged in multiple theatres of conflict, including Iran‑sourced strikes in the Middle East.
